Today's fixture pits Real Salt Lake against FC Dallas in a Major League Soccer clash, and while the home side is riding a wave of momentum, I've crunched the numbers to see if any underdog value is lurking in the shadows.

Real Salt Lake is currently operating like a well-oiled machine at home. Over their last five matches at this venue, they've secured four wins, scoring an impressive 2.80 goals per game while keeping a tight defensive line that concedes just 0.60 per outing. Their recent form shows a 40% win rate across their last ten matches overall, with a 1.60 points-per-game average. The attacking metrics back this up: 13.67 shots per game on average, with shot accuracy jumping to 47.2% at home. They are clearly the market favorite, priced at 1.83 for a home win.

On the other side, FC Dallas arrives as the true underdog at 3.75. Historically, this fixture has been a playground for the visitors, with Dallas winning six of the last ten meetings, including four of those at RSL's home turf. Their most recent encounter ended in a 3-1 victory for Dallas. However, recent form tells a more nuanced story. Dallas has shown resilience on the road, winning 50% of their last eight away games, averaging 1.38 goals scored and 1.25 conceded. Their away possession sits at 35.0%, relying on efficient transitions rather than dominating the ball.
